Transaction 78879f043e79e290e2ffe4bec5cc519232503605ed85fb8b63b1ca636bd7b6a6

1 Input
1 Outputs
  • 78879f043e79e290e2ffe4bec5cc519232503605ed85fb8b63b1ca636bd7b6a6:0
  • value  1124800
    address  3D3fVSsceJaPHXjmJdfCeMompHE4F7csSv